Is anyone aware of a trojan living on this port?
<snip> I'm not aware of a trojan, but that's one of the default ports for a Real Media server. There have been a couple of DoS attacks published recently for them. I can't really imagine someone would go portscanning for them, though, unless a more insteresting exploit was available. Ryan
